Legendary Toon Designer Gene Hazelton Dies


April 12, 2005 by Sarah Gurman No Comments divider image

Famed animation designer/comic strip artist Gene Hazleton passed away on April 6, 2005 at age 85. Born in 1919, Wesley "Gene" Hazelton began an extensive and diverse career in his teens as an assistant to Jimmy Halto, working on the popular newspaper panel They’ll Do It Every Time. He jumped [...]
